    Occam’s Dream – A Sci-Fi Novella That Dares to Ask: How Do You Live When You Can’t Trust Your Own Mind?

    Barnett is a gripping psychological science-fiction mystery that explores the deep emotional terrain of trauma, fear, and the fragile power of trust. The novella is available now through Collective Ink Press, Amazon, Waterstones, and Goodreads.

    Set in a near-future London, Occam’s Dream follows Ursula, a dream analyst returning to work after a leave of absence—only to be tormented by disturbing visions of a desert that interrupt her waking life. As she seeks answers from her therapist Jill, she is drawn into a deeper mystery surrounding her work and a powerful tech company called SWAN, which has pioneered revolutionary carbon-to-oxygen conversion machines.

    Told through the perspectives of Ursula, Jill, and SWAN’s enigmatic founder Mackenzie, the novella dives into questions of memory, trust, and identity—particularly through the lens of middle-aged female protagonists, a rare focus in science fiction.

    “It’s an emotionally intense ride with sharp prose, unpredictable twists, and an ending that will leave you breathless,” says Infinity Magazine.

    Barnett’s storytelling is deeply personal. At 18, she survived the traumatic loss of both parents, murdered by her younger brother. The emotional fallout of that tragedy echoes through Occam’s Dream, where characters wrestle with self-doubt, mental health, and the haunting weight of past trauma. “I gave Ursula my own fear,” Lauren explains. “That inability to trust your mind, your memories, your reality. I needed to write through it.”

    While rooted in psychological depth, the novella also offers an accessible, binge-worthy format—just 135 pages packed with suspense, ideal for readers with busy lives or shorter attention spans. Think Philip K. Dick meets Shirley Jackson, with a distinctly feminist and contemporary edge.

    As a member of the UK’s vibrant indie horror scene, Lauren is known for her punchy twist endings and female-driven narratives. She’s also co-host of the London Horror Movie Club podcast, and an active presence on the horror convention circuit, including upcoming appearances at HorrorCon UK and Shed of Hell.

    With themes of environmental ethics, technology, and personal resilience, Occam’s Dream is more than a mystery—it’s a haunting, hopeful reflection on what it means to move forward when everything feels uncertain.
